Natural Environment Supplementary Planning Document (SPD)
Walsall Council is consulting on the draft Natural Environment Supplementary Planning Document (SPD) that provides guidance on complying with the existing and emerging Local Plan and National policies and guidance for the protection of the natural environment, including issues such as ‘biodiversity net gain’, protected species and habitats to ensure it is properly considered in the development management process.

This SPD will sit alongside other supporting SPD and planning guidance documents produced by the Walsall Council, while superseding the current Conserving Walsall’s Natural Environment SPD once published.
